Why Standing Trees (aka Snags) can be the Hottest Trend in Borrego Springs

Borrego Springs is known for its natural beauty and breathtaking landscapes. However, with a desert climate and limited water resources, it can be challenging to maintain lush gardens and green lawns. That’s where standing trees come in. While they may not provide shade or produce fruit, they do offer a unique visual element that can transform your property.

Here are just a few reasons why you should consider leaving your dead or dying trees standing:

  1. They provide a home for wildlife – Snags are essential habitat for many bird species, including woodpeckers, owls, and hawks. These birds use the holes and crevices in the trees for nesting, roosting, and feeding.
  2. They’re low maintenance – Unlike living trees, standing trees require very little maintenance. You don’t need to worry about watering, pruning, or fertilizing them.
  3. They’re a conversation starter – Standing trees are sure to grab the attention of your guests and neighbors. They’re a unique and interesting feature that will set your property apart from others.
